> We're working away on getting the Remix ready, so here's a brief summary of
> what we got accomplished today:
>
> - bcm2835 is packaged up and awaiting review

Link?

> - naming inconsistencies in the raspi override repo have been mostly removed

Where is the repository for those of us that wish to test it without the rest?

> - The release package issues have been fixed, pending testing

Why aren't we just using the upstream generic-release rather than
spinning something different?

> - Fossjon has made a lot of progress on our fancy openGL splash screen
> - The current raspi kernel has been put in the override repository

Again link please.
